--- GOD'S
CREATION ---
1
In the beginning God created the heaven and
the earth. 2 And the earth was without form, and void; and
darkness was upon the face of the deep. And the Spirit of God
moved upon the face of the waters. 3 And God said, Let there be
light: and there was light. 4 And God saw the light, that it
was good: and God divided the light from the darkness. 5 And
God called the light Day, and the darkness he called Night. And the
evening and the morning were the first day. 6
And God said, Let there be a firmament in the midst of the waters, and
let it divide the waters from the waters. 7 And God made the
firmament, and divided the waters which were under the firmament
from the waters which were above the firmament: and it was so. 8
And God called the firmament Heaven. And the evening and the morning
were the second day. 9 And
God said, Let the waters under the heaven be gathered together unto one
place, and let the dry land appear: and it was so. 10 And
God called the dry land Earth; and the gathering together of the
waters called he Seas: and God saw that it was good. AThese
are the generations of the heavens and of the earth when they
were created, in the day that the LORD God made the earth and the
heavens, And every plant of the
field before it was in the earth, and every herb of the field before it
grew: for the LORD God had not caused it to rain upon the earth, and there
was not a man to till the ground. But
there went up a mist from the earth, and watered the whole face of the
ground. 11 And
God said, Let the earth bring forth grass, the herb yielding seed, and
the fruit tree yielding fruit after his kind, whose seed is in
itself, upon the earth: and it was so. 12 And the earth brought
forth grass, and herb yielding seed after his kind, and the tree
yielding fruit, whose seed was in itself, after his kind: and God
saw that it was good. 13 And the evening and the morning
were the third day. 14 And
God said, Let there be lights in the firmament of the heaven to divide
the day from the night; and let them be for signs, and for seasons, and
for days, and years: 15 And let them be for lights in the
firmament of the heaven to give light upon the earth: and it was so. 16
And God made two great lights; the greater light to rule the day,
and the lesser light to rule the night: he made the stars also. 17
And God set them in the firmament of the heaven to give light upon
the earth, 18 And to rule over the day and over the night, and to
divide the light from the darkness: and God saw that it was good.
19 And the evening and the morning were the fourth day. 20
And God said, Let the waters bring forth abundantly the moving
creature that hath life, and fowl that may fly above the earth in
the open firmament of heaven. 21 And God created great whales,
and every living creature that moveth, which the waters brought forth
abundantly, after their kind, and every winged fowl after his kind: and
God saw that it was good. 22 And God blessed them, saying,
Be fruitful, and multiply, and fill the waters in the seas, and let fowl
multiply in the earth 23 And the evening and the morning were the
fifth day. 24 And God said,
Let the earth bring forth the living creature after his kind, cattle,
and creeping thing, and beast of the earth after his kind: and it was
so. 25 And God made the beast of the earth after his kind, and
cattle after their kind, and every thing that creepeth upon the earth
after his kind: and God saw that it was good.
